The transition to the patient driven payment model (PDPM) over the last two years has not been without its challenges. COVID-19 shifted SNFs’ priorities away from the PDPM transition during year one to an all-hands-on deck approach to prevent the spread of the virus.
Year two continued to bring fresh challenges, including the ongoing pandemic response and an administration change that impacted nursing facility operations and the way care is delivered.

Did you know the Patient-Driven Patient Model (PDPM) increased payments to SNF’s in Year 1 by $1.7 billion when it was expected to be budget neutral?
